Output c07c58a52f168e75abbe4e886e58a5f3f0d65b0403fe62bfb7dddc03aa884fd3:3

value
12682136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22042affb8431a8a93381ad2d8c2f2fe2ad2ad06 OP_EQUAL
address
MB12CYicpV3emREu7G4BagibY326SGssfw
transaction
c07c58a52f168e75abbe4e886e58a5f3f0d65b0403fe62bfb7dddc03aa884fd3
spent
true